Liverpool will face PSG in the Last-16 of the Champions League next month after the Reds learned their path to the final on Friday.
John Aldridge has some concerns about Liverpool drawing PSG as the Ligue 1 outfit have been in top form since the turn of the year and are currently leading the French league by 10 points after 22 games.

The biggest concern for Liverpool when they come up against PSG next month will be the French club’s forward line of Khvicha Kvaratskhelia, Ousmane Dembele and Bradley Barcola.
If you are Liverpool, if you take care of them, and more importantly, if you deny them the ball, then that’s why Liverpool will be favourites because I think in the other departments Liverpool are way stronger.”
Liverpool travel to Paris on 5 March before the Reds host the Ligue 1 champions in the return leg on 11 March at Anfield.
